Cost and Payment. Due to the fact that (i) the license for the use of the Cellphone Games Software and the service provided by the Licensee are major parts that are indispensable for the commencement of the value-added telecommunication service business of the Licensee, (ii) the development of the value-added telecommunication service business provided by the Licensor to any terminal user is to a large extent dependent upon the quality of such software and its technical service, and (iii) the Licensor of the Cellphone Games Software has devoted a substantial amount of human and material resources on the development of the Cellphone Games Software and is required to provide the services and guarantees set forth in Clauses 1.2.1 to 1.2.3 to the Licensee during the term hereof on a long-term basis, the Licensor and the Licensee, after consultation, agree that the Licensee shall make the following payments to the Licensor in accordance with the requirements as follows: 3.1 During the license period of the Cellphone Games Software, the Licensee shall pay to the Licensor a software license fee and technical service fee which are equivalent to 50% of the actual revenue of a product arising out of the use of such Cellphone Games Software. 3.2 The actual revenue of the product shall be derived from the book sales revenue of the Licensee after deduction of the amount owed to mobile operators. The Licensee shall submit to the Licensor a statement of sales revenue regarding the Cellphone Games Software of the previous month within 7 days after the end of each month. 3.3 The Licensee shall, within one month after the expiration of this Agreement, continue to pay to the Licensor all the software license fees in connection with the revenues received prior to its expiration and which is payable but has not yet been paid under this Agreement.
